What is Comr.se?
Comr.se operates at the intersection of trade logistics and enterprise-level export assistance. The company provides specialized support services, notably through its alignment with the Washington State Trade Office Department of Commerce Export Washington program. How much funding has Comr.se raised?
Comr.se has raised a total of $1.7M across 1 funding round:
Angel/Seed
$1.7M
Angel/Seed (2013): $1.7M, investors not publicly disclosed
